Gov. Sule, Top Officials Honour Fallen Heroes At Nasarawa Armed Forces Remembrance Day

Also Read

By Suleiman Abubakar Rimi Uku, Lafia


Governor of Nasarawa State, Engr. Abdullahi A. Sule, on Thursday led top government officials and traditional rulers in Lafia to commemorate the 2026 Armed Forces Remembrance Day, laying wreaths in honour of Nigerian fallen heroes.

Among dignitaries at the ceremony were the Deputy Governor, Dr. Emmanuel Akabe; the Emir of Lafia, Justice Sidi Bage (rtd); the Honourable Attorney-General and Commissioner for Justice, Bar. Isaac Danladi; and heads of security agencies. 

The governor also signed the remembrance register and released white pigeons to symbolise peace and national unity.

The Armed Forces Remembrance Day is marked annually on January 15 to honour members of the Nigerian Armed Forces who paid the ultimate price in defence of the nation.
